    Sound quality at certain volume levels is almost exactly the same. Kind of unbelievable. It is as though Apple reverse engineered the Bose 700 and copied its sound signature and noice canceling to within 5 percent. There is a definite sound quality difference though that changes with the volume level. This is all about the DSP. Of course, the digital signal processing (DSP) is called Computational Audio on the Max and Volume Optimized EQ on the Bose. This is what works differently and what accounts for sound differences dependent on the volume. Basically, the Bose sound better at 60 percent volume and below. Bose just has it dialed in so that everything sounds rich and balanced. I usually listen to music at about 55 percent volume on my iPad. So, I prefer the sound of the Bose. The sound at 60 percent and below on the AirPods Max suffers from a veiled upper midrange. An alto saxophone, for example, will sound as though it is being played behind a wooden door.

    I am an avid user and loyal to the Sony XM4. They have been the best noise canceling super base mid and low range Bluetooth over the air headset that I have ever experienced….. until now. The Apple AirPod promax is by far the best quality Bluetooth and wired headphones I have ever experienced. Now with spatial audio the quality for all genres of music is exemplary. Granted They are heavier but due to the mesh headband which rests and distributes the weight so evenly you don’t even know you’re wearing them. The headband and ear cushions are replaceable and quality build is far superior to any competitor. Noise Cancellation is the best I have ever heard together with the nine microphones using these on teleconference is a pleasure. Watching movies whilst wearing these is comparable to my Bose surround system. I found a wonderful slim fitting highly protective case with auto shut off function on Amazon which completes the package

    All I can say is WOW!!! For a 1st generation, Apple pretty much hit this out of the park. If the price point was $400-$450, this would have easily gotten a 5 Star. There are a few cons that I want to point out on these. Price is the biggest con with these. I cannot justify paying $550 + Tax for a pair of headphones for a typical non audiophile user. As a normal consumer, $400 is pushing the upper limits for a pair of headphones, but because this is Apple, they priced these higher than normal because they can actually get away with it. The other cons are the case and not having a 3.5mm adapter if you want to plug it into an airplane or computer. First off, both of these are not deal breakers for me, it would have been nice for them to include a 3.5mm jack, but being that it's Apple, they will find any way they can to squeeze consumers for every last penny. The case does what it needs to for the most part. I am concerned that the mesh part of the head band is not protected at all since that's the most vulnerable part. But, this will lead 3rd parties to come up with a protective sleeve or cover for it. The AirPods Max are heavier than the competition due to the aluminum & stainless steel material used here. Apple did not cut corners when they designed this and I am glad because they do not look or feel cheap at all. Starting to see why they charged $550. They look classy in a throwback kind of way. The ear cups and head band don't protrude out and pretty much follows the curvature of your head. Despite it being heavier, the mesh band does a great job at spreading the weight out as to not develop any pain at the crown of my head. The clamping design on the ear cups will bear most of the weight. The ear cushions are nice and soft and I did not feel my ears getting hot or sticky like the leatherette ear cups on the competitions. Even though I didn't feel any pain on the crown after hours of usage, I did notice that my neck was a little sore. If that's the case, you can just lie down or lean your head back on to a pillow or something. As for the sound, these are the best sounding headphones I have owned. My go to prior to this was the B&W PX7's. I really like the sound on these because it was balanced and clean without too much bass to muddy up the sound. The Sony XM4's would be great if they were the only headphones on earth, but they are not and I am not too much of a fan of their sound signature. I feel they are a little too warm and bass heavy that muddies up the mid's and highs for me. They too also got hot after wearing for a while. The AirPods Max are well balanced with just the enough bass to give the song a little life. Although, I did wish there was a little bit more sub-bass for the rumble effect. But all in all, the sound on these are so clean and does not distort even at max level. The sound separation are so great that I am able to hear more instruments on these than any other headphones I've tried. If you have an iPhone, you can go in and change the settings around to boost the soft sounds. You can do this by going into Settings/Accessories/Audio/Visual/Headphone Accommodations. I have my set at Balanced Tone and Moderate. If you have the money to spend and in the Apple eco-system, these will be the best money spent for your ears. Just keep in mind that out of the box, they might not sound great, but after some burn in time, you will start to appreciate what Apple has done with these.
